- Established in 1996, the Institute for Behavioral Medicine Research is the cornerstone of a broad research program at Ohio State into the realm of psychoneuroimmunology (PNI)  the study of how the brain interacts with the body's immune system.

For more than a quarter-century, scientists here have led an effort that has moved this area of study from a novel curiosity to an important scientific field, one that has great implications for public health and great promise for enhancing medical treatments. more>
